Care Tips:

  • Light: 4–6 hours of direct or bright filtered sunlight daily.

  • Water: Only use distilled, rain, or reverse osmosis water. Keep soil moist, not soggy.

  • Soil: Use nutrient-free carnivorous mix (peat moss & perlite).

  • Dormancy: Allow a 3-month winter dormancy period for long-term health.
